Foot Locker announces new chief executive as Ken Hicks retires

06/11/2014
New York-based athletic footwear retail group Foot Locker has announced that chief executive, Ken Hicks, intends to retire on December 1, 2014. He will continue as executive chairman of the board until the company’s annual general meeting in May 2015 but will then step down from the board.

Mr Hicks will be succeeded as chief executive by Dick Johnson, who has been with Foot Locker for 17 years, serving as chief operating officer since May 2012.
